EKEKO

A figurine of a short, homely man laden with many objects, representing abundance. (The EKEKO is a traditional Andean god of prosperity honored during the Alasitas festival, where people purchase miniatures of goods they hope to acquire in the coming year.)

I bought an EKEKO at the Alasitas festival so that my business has good luck this year.
